1 # $NetBSD: Makefile,v 1.3 2025/03/02 00:03:41 riastradh Exp $ 2 3 WARNS=9 4 5 .include <bsd.init.mk> 6 7 GPT=${NETBSDSRCDIR}/sbin/gpt 8 9 .PATH: ${GPT} 10 11 CFLAGS+= -Wno-address-of-packed-member 12 CPPFLAGS+= -I${GPT} 13 DPADD+= ${LIBUTIL} 14 LDADD+= -lutil 15 16 PROG= efi 17 MAN= ${PROG}.8 18 19 SRCS= main.c 20 SRCS+= bootvar.c 21 SRCS+= certs.c 22 SRCS+= devpath.c 23 SRCS+= devpath1.c 24 SRCS+= devpath2.c 25 SRCS+= devpath3.c 26 SRCS+= devpath4.c 27 SRCS+= devpath5.c 28 SRCS+= efiio.c 29 SRCS+= getvars.c 30 SRCS+= gpt.c 31 SRCS+= gpt_uuid.c 32 SRCS+= gptsubr.c 33 SRCS+= map.c 34 SRCS+= setvar.c 35 SRCS+= showvar.c 36 SRCS+= utils.c 37 38 .include <bsd.prog.mk> 39